Transaction 40f431567be312ada01730f6904440c1919ac287c7cf7da22d5c25849ce46bed

1 Input
2 Outputs
  • 40f431567be312ada01730f6904440c1919ac287c7cf7da22d5c25849ce46bed:0
  • value  20000000
    address  3FvF8gpHLXE4PNEXTbRo3pEaabViTBcXGR
  • 40f431567be312ada01730f6904440c1919ac287c7cf7da22d5c25849ce46bed:1
  • value  108949638
    address  1MfybwzKmc7UPZGMWLFti3a3K1FH9EUYDT